Meyer Distributing is looking for a Warehouse Operator to join our Orlando team.
Meyer Distributing is a complete wholesale distributor: automotive, RV/towing, outdoor living, marine, and more. With 85+ locations across the country, Meyer services dealers nationwide. Meyer Logistics is a transportation company that serves as the backbone of Meyer Distributing’s shipping network. Meyer Logistics has a fleet of 500+ top-of-the-line trucks. The Warehouse Operator loads and unloads trucks, stocks products in appropriate locations, pulls stock and stages products for shipping, ensuring accuracy and timeliness of all job functions.
Preferred Experience For Warehouse Operator
- EDUCATION/CERTIFICATION: High School graduate or equivalent preferred.
- TRAINING: Minimum of one month on the job training required.
- EXPERIENCE: Previous warehouse experience and ability to operate a forklift or man lift (cherry picker) preferred.
Requirements For Warehouse Operator
- Ability to lift up to 75 pounds
- Ability to engage in repetitious bending and lifting
- Ability to operate Forklift or Manlift (cherry picker)
- Must obtain forklift and manlift certification within 3 months
- Must be able to work up to 25 feet above ground level
- Must not be afraid of heights
Warehouse Worker Duties Include But Are Not Limited To
- Unloads trucks and distributes products to appropriate area of warehouse for restocking
- Uses scanners to place parts in proper bins and pulls orders
- Stocks parts on racks in proper location
- Fills orders from warehouse stock and distributes items to shipping or to designated route driver/customer pick-up staging area
- Places product on pallets and wraps it in film and bands it using banding equipment
- Assists in counting and reconciliation of physical inventory
- Keeps warehouse and work area clean and organized at all times
- Wear protective toed shoes and work in a safe manner at all times
- Moves products manually and with the assistance of a forklift and manlift
- Loads trucks and secures product
- All other duties as assigned
